Arriving in Belfast
Belfast International Airport (BFS)
The distance from Belfast International Airport (BFS) to central Belfast is approximately 19 kilometres. It takes about 25 minutes to reach the centre driving.
Getting there by public transport will take you around 45 minutes.

Belfast City Airport (BHD)
Central Belfast is located around 5 kilometres from Belfast City Airport (BHD). As soon as your flight from Phoenix to Belfast has landed and you've navigated your way to arrivals, expect a drive of about 15 minutes.
If you're catching public transport, it'll take around 25 minutes.

Best time to go to Belfast
September is the busiest month for flights from Phoenix to Belfast. To avoid the crowds, go to Belfast in February.
The warmest month in Belfast is July, with temperatures ranging between 9ºC (48ºF) and 19ºC (66ºF). Lock in your Phoenix to Belfast ticket then if that's your idea of comfortable weather.
January has average temperatures of between 1ºC (34ºF) and 8ºC (46ºF). Search for cheap flights from Phoenix to Belfast around that time if you want to travel when it's cooler.
